    • RE: Midi Player Clock Sync (problem)

      I finally managed to reach a solution.

      For me, at least, it works fine for now. I don’t know if there was an easier solution, but for me, being able to sync that grid when I modify the tempo (for the internal clock), this change worked. I’ll leave below the function I modified in the source code.

      MasterClock::GridInfo MasterClock::processAndCheckGrid(int numSamples,
      	const AudioPlayHead::CurrentPositionInfo& externalInfo)
      {	
      	GridInfo gi;
      
          auto shouldUseExternalBpm = !linkBpmToSync || !shouldPreferInternal();
      	
          if (bpm != externalInfo.bpm && shouldUseExternalBpm)
              setBpm(externalInfo.bpm);
      
          if (currentSyncMode == SyncModes::Inactive)
              return gi;
          
          // .. ADDED .. //
      
          // Store last tempo for detection
          static double lastBpm = -1.0;
          static double bpmSmooth = bpm; // Smoothed BPM
          static double lastPpqPosition = 0.0; // Store last PPQ position
      	
          bool tempoChanged = (bpm != lastBpm); // Detect tempo change
           
          if (tempoChanged)
              lastBpm = bpm;
      
          // Interpolate BPM smoothly over time
          double smoothingFactor = 0.1; // Lower = smoother, Higher = faster response
          bpmSmooth += (bpm - bpmSmooth) * smoothingFactor;
      
          // Convert BPM to quarter notes in samples (using smoothed BPM)
          const auto quarterInSamples = (double)TempoSyncer::getTempoInSamples(bpmSmooth, sampleRate, 1.0f);
      
          // Instead of relying on uptime, calculate PPQ dynamically (like in updateFromExternalPlayHead)
          double ppqTime = lastPpqPosition + ((double)numSamples / quarterInSamples);
          lastPpqPosition = ppqTime;
      
          // Calculate grid alignment based on PPQ (like in updateFromExternalPlayHead)
          double multiplier = (double)TempoSyncer::getTempoFactor(clockGrid);
          double nextGridPPQ = std::ceil(ppqTime / multiplier) * multiplier;
          double nextGridSamples = nextGridPPQ * quarterInSamples;
          samplesToNextGrid = nextGridSamples - (ppqTime * quarterInSamples);
      
          if (currentSyncMode == SyncModes::SyncInternal && externalInfo.isPlaying)
          {
              uptime = ppqTime * quarterInSamples;
              samplesToNextGrid = gridDelta - (uptime % gridDelta);
          }
      
          // ... added up to here
      
          if (currentState != nextState)
          {
              currentState = nextState;
              uptime = numSamples - nextTimestamp;
              currentGridIndex = 0;
      
              if (currentState != State::Idle && gridEnabled)
              {
                  gi.change = true;
                  gi.timestamp = nextTimestamp;
                  gi.gridIndex = currentGridIndex;
                  gi.firstGridInPlayback = true;
                  samplesToNextGrid = gridDelta - nextTimestamp;
              }
      
              nextTimestamp = 0;
          }
          else
          {
              if (currentState == State::Idle)
              {   
      			uptime = 0;
      			lastPpqPosition = 0.0; // Added ... to reset PpqPosition
      		}
              else
              {	
                  jassert(nextTimestamp == 0);
                  uptime += numSamples;
                  samplesToNextGrid -= numSamples;
      
                  if (samplesToNextGrid < 0 && gridEnabled)
                  {
                      currentGridIndex++;
                      gi.change = true;
                      gi.firstGridInPlayback = waitForFirstGrid;
                      waitForFirstGrid = false;
                      gi.gridIndex = currentGridIndex;
                      gi.timestamp = numSamples + samplesToNextGrid;
                      samplesToNextGrid += gridDelta;
                  }
              }
          }
      
          return gi;
      }

    • Midi Player Clock Sync (problem)

      Hello guys,

      I have a problem,

      If I have a MIDI player and try to press play using startInternalClock(0), even though I have checked the "Prefer External" synchronization option, when I change the tempo from that DAW simulator in HISE, a desynchronization occurs. On the other hand, if I press play from that DAW simulator, even if I aggressively change the tempo, everything works perfectly, and there are no desynchronizations of that grid changer.
